&lt;p&gt;This is the follow up to my previous post about redesigning the &lt;a href="http://matt.cc/post/212251069"&gt;Scrabble logo&lt;/a&gt;. This is the entire academic project: my concept for &lt;b&gt;redesigning the Scrabble packaging&lt;/b&gt;. My design strips away the need for a box to hold your board and instead turns the package into the product. This new Scrabble board functions more like a book, featuring the logo and instructions on the outside, with a board on the inside that’s revealed as you open the package. The two pieces/boxes that make up the package and board are hollow and features tabs at the top that can be opened. This is where you’ll find your Scrabble pieces and tiles. To keep the package shut, I embedded two magnets in the material on opposite sides of the board.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;The new package is only about 10 inches tall, so it can fit comfortably on a bookshelf, no need to stack it on top of or underneath other board games. This package also cuts down on materials used to make the game. There’s no need to put a box or slip around this, the cover serves as a display for the product on store shelves. &lt;p&gt;This is just one part of a larger academic project in which I’m taking the Scrabble packaging (the board, the tiles, the box) and re-imagining &amp; redesigning it. One of my first steps in the process was redesigning the wordmark. In case you weren’t aware, Scrabble rebranded in March 2008, ditched the &lt;a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/File:Scrabble_United_States.jpg"&gt;iconic logo&lt;/a&gt; that I’m sure we all remember as kids, and moved towards a slicker, &lt;a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/File:Scrabble-na-logo.svg"&gt;more contemporary looking wordmark&lt;/a&gt;. There are a few elements of the wordmark that I think are good, but for the most part, I don’t like it. I think it abandons too much of the original wordmark’s character and I think dropping the ‘S’ especially is a mistake.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;So I tried identifying exactly what I like about the old and the new, pointing it out, and redesigning from there. I wanted to revive some heritage and clean up some problem areas. Above you can see some of the process and the result.&lt;/p&gt;
